
Ep. 027 - OpenAI Jalapeño: Better Than Nvidia Blackwell (Accelerators)
SemiAnalysis Weekly
OpenAI’s custom ASIC, Jalapeno, redefines inference efficiency by outperforming Nvidia’s Vera Rubin on a performance-per-megawatt and total cost of ownership basis. Despite having lower theoretical specifications, the chip achieves superior throughput by utilizing a microarchitecture that minimizes data movement and employs AI-generated kernels to optimize performance. This breakthrough demonstrates the power of vertical integration, where frontier model labs leverage their own advanced models to accelerate silicon design and software bring-up, effectively bypassing traditional hardware development bottlenecks. The rapid nine-month cycle from initial concept to tape-out highlights a shift in industry dynamics, suggesting that AI-assisted design will become a critical competitive advantage. By successfully deploying a custom chip that handles both high-interactivity and high-throughput workloads, OpenAI challenges Nvidia’s market dominance and signals a new era of specialized, model-driven hardware development.
